Area contextNeighborhood Overview – Bridges Center (Athens, TX)
The Bridges Center is situated in Athens, Texas, a city located about 75 miles southeast of Dallas. Its location is accessible via US Highway 19, which runs through the heart of the city. For those arriving by air, the closest major airport is Dallas/Fort Worth International Airport (DFW), which is approximately a 1.5 to 2-hour drive, depending on traffic. Tyler Pounds Regional Airport (TYR) is closer, about a 45-minute drive, but offers fewer flight options. Navigating Athens is generally straightforward with Highway 19 and State Highway 31 being the primary thoroughfares. Parking at the Bridges Center is typically ample, with dedicated lots available. Rideshare services are available in Athens, though availability might be more limited compared to larger cities, especially during off-peak hours. Planning your arrival to allow for potential traffic, particularly around major events, is always a smart strategy. Consider arriving 30-45 minutes before your scheduled event to ensure a relaxed entry and time to familiarize yourself with the facilities.

Texas Freshwater Fisheries Center
The Texas Freshwater Fisheries Center is a premier destination for anyone interested in aquatic life and Texas fishing heritage. Visitors can explore interactive exhibits on fish species, conservation efforts, and the art of fly fishing. The center features a large aquarium, casting ponds, and a working fish hatchery, offering a unique educational experience for all ages. It’s an excellent option for a family outing or a relaxing afternoon away from competitive events.

Weather & Seasons at Bridges Center
- Winter: Winter in Athens typically brings mild temperatures, with daytime highs often in the 50s and dropping into the 30s at night. Visitors should pack layers, including sweaters, light jackets, and perhaps a heavier coat for cooler evenings. Outdoor events are feasible on warmer days, but it’s wise to have a contingency plan for sudden temperature drops or rain.
- Spring & early summer: Spring offers increasingly warm weather, with temperatures rising into the 70s and 80s. This season is beautiful for outdoor activities, but be prepared for possible spring showers and higher humidity. Lightweight clothing, including short sleeves and pants, is recommended, along with a light raincoat or umbrella.
- Mid-summer: Mid-summer in Athens is characterized by heat and humidity, with daytime temperatures frequently reaching the 90s and sometimes exceeding 100°F. Staying hydrated is crucial. Lightweight, breathable fabrics like cotton and linen are essential. Early morning and evening events are generally more comfortable than midday activities.
- Fall season: Fall brings a welcome respite from the summer heat, with temperatures cooling into the 60s and 70s. This is arguably one of the most pleasant times to visit. Layers remain a good idea, as mornings can be crisp, and afternoons warm. A light jacket or sweater is usually sufficient for comfort.
- Rain & snow: Rain is possible year-round in Athens, with spring and fall often seeing the most precipitation. Snow is infrequent and usually light, melting quickly. During rainy periods, indoor activities or venues with good shelter are preferable. Ensure footwear is suitable for wet conditions, and always check weather forecasts before heading to an event.
